Science Daily (http://www.sciencedaily.com/) — Tufts University researchers are developing techniques that could allow computers to respond to users' thoughts of frustration -- too much work -- or boredom--too little work. Applying non-invasive and easily portable imaging technology in new ways, they hope to gain real-time insight into the brain's more subtle emotional cues and help provide a more efficient way to get work done....Read on here - http://www.sciencedaily.com/releases/2007/10/071001125649.htm
